Legal Requirements & Penalties in GA

Georgia law requires workers' compensation coverage for most businesses with three or more employees. Failure to comply can result in fines, penalties, and potential lawsuits. The system is designed to provide benefits for work-related injuries without regard to fault.

Industry Risk Factors & Class Codes

Premiums are based on classification codes assigned to job roles. High-risk industries like agriculture pay more than low-risk ones like office work. Keeping accurate records helps reduce costs.

Frequently Asked Questions

What does workers compensation insurance cover?

It covers medical expenses, lost wages, and rehabilitation for employees injured at work, as well as liability protection for employers.

Is workers compensation required in Cobbtown?

Yes, just like the rest of GA, employers in Cobbtown must provide coverage or face fines and penalties.
